上一页 1 ··· 25 26 27 28 29 30 31 32 33 ··· 44 下一页
摘要: 创世纪 1989 年,任职于欧洲核子研究中心(CERN)的蒂姆·伯纳斯 - 李(Tim Berners-Lee)发表了一篇论文,提出了在互联网上构建超链接文档系统的构想。这篇论文中他确立了三项关键技术。 URI:即统一资源标识符,作为互联网上资源的唯一身份; HTML:即超文本标记语言,描述超文本文 阅读全文
posted @ 2022-02-09 17:55 r1-12king 阅读(40) 评论(0) 推荐(0) 编辑
摘要: TCP/IP TCP/IP 协议是目前网络世界“事实上”的标准通信协议。TCP/IP 协议实际上是一系列网络通信协议的统称,其中最核心的两个协议是 TCP 和 IP,其他的还有 UDP、ICMP、ARP 等等,共同构成了一个复杂但有层次的协议栈。 这个协议栈有四层,最上层是“应用层”,最下层是“链接 阅读全文
posted @ 2022-02-09 17:38 r1-12king 阅读(62) 评论(0) 推荐(0) 编辑
摘要: 一、前言 之前谈到缓存时,主要讲了客户端(浏览器)上的缓存控制,它能够减少响应时间、节约带宽,提升客户端的用户体验。 但 HTTP 传输链路上,不只是客户端有缓存,服务器上的缓存也是非常有价值的,可以让请求不必走完整个后续处理流程,“就近”获得响应结果。 特别是对于那些“读多写少”的数据,例如突发热 阅读全文
posted @ 2022-02-09 17:09 r1-12king 阅读(124) 评论(0) 推荐(0) 编辑
摘要: 代理服务 “代理”这个词听起来好像很神秘,有点“高大上”的感觉。 但其实 HTTP 协议里对它并没有什么特别的描述,它就是在客户端和服务器原本的通信链路中插入的一个中间环节,也是一台服务器,但提供的是“代理服务”。 所谓的“代理服务”就是指服务本身不生产内容,而是处于中间位置转发上下游的请求和响应, 阅读全文
posted @ 2022-02-09 16:28 r1-12king 阅读(543) 评论(0) 推荐(0) 编辑
摘要: 一、前言 由于请求-应答模式的通信成本比较高,所以有必要将某些数据进行缓存,从而节省带宽。 缓存是优化系统性能的重要手段,HTTP 传输的每一个环节中都可以有缓存; 二、服务器的缓存控制 2.1 缓存控制的流程 浏览器发现缓存无数据,于是发送请求,向服务器获取资源; 服务器响应请求,返回资源,同时标 阅读全文
posted @ 2022-02-09 15:28 r1-12king 阅读(133) 评论(0) 推荐(0) 编辑
摘要: 无状态的http协议 http是无状态的,这即是优点也是缺点。优点是服务器没有状态差异,可以很容易的组成集群。缺点是无法记录需要状态记录的事务操作。 HTTP 协议是可扩展的,后来发明的 Cookie 技术,给 HTTP 增加了“记忆能力”。 什么是cookie cookie来源于计算机编程里的术语 阅读全文
posted @ 2022-02-09 14:22 r1-12king 阅读(33) 评论(0) 推荐(0) 编辑
摘要: 主动跳转和被动跳转 主动跳转:跳转动作是通过浏览器的使用者发起的 被动跳转:跳转动作是通过浏览器自动进行的,称为『重定向』 重定向状态码 301 永久重定向 原URI永久的不存在了,今后的所有请求都必须改用新的URI 浏览器看到 301,就知道原来的 URI“过时”了,就会做适当的优化。比如历史记录 阅读全文
posted @ 2022-02-09 11:54 r1-12king 阅读(199) 评论(0) 推荐(0) 编辑
摘要: 前言 在数据量过大时,为了保存大量数据,一般有两种方法中:使用大内存云主机和切片集群。 实际上,这两种方法分别对应着 Redis 应对数据量增多的两种方案:纵向扩展(scale up)和横向扩展(scale out)。 纵向扩展:升级单个 Redis 实例的资源配置,包括增加内存容量、增加磁盘容量、 阅读全文
posted @ 2022-02-08 17:27 r1-12king 阅读(61) 评论(0) 推荐(0) 编辑
摘要: 前言 哨兵机制,它可以实现主从库的自动切换。通过部署多个实例,就形成了一个哨兵集群。哨兵集群中的多个实例共同判断,可以降低对主库下线的误判率。 一个新的问题:如果有哨兵实例在运行时发生了故障,主从库还能正常切换吗? 实际上,一旦多个实例组成了哨兵集群,即使有哨兵实例出现故障挂掉了,其他哨兵还能继续协 阅读全文
posted @ 2022-02-08 17:07 r1-12king 阅读(36) 评论(0) 推荐(0) 编辑
摘要: 前言 在主从库集群模式下,如果从库故障,主库可以继续工作;但是如果主库挂了,会影响到从库的数据同步。 如果客户端是读请求,从库还可以继续响应,但是如果是写请求,由于Redis的读写分离机制,因此没有实例可以响应客户端的写请求。如图 图1 主库故障后从库无法服务写操作 无论是无法数据同步,还是无法响应 阅读全文
posted @ 2022-02-08 16:18 r1-12king 阅读(180) 评论(0) 推荐(0) 编辑
上一页 1 ··· 25 26 27 28 29 30 31 32 33 ··· 44 下一页